I'm looking for a little guidance.  I've got two SSIDs, one open and one 
secured.  They both use mac auth against packetfence.  I don't want the clients 
that are registered for certain roles to connect to the unsecured SSID.  Can I 
use a radius filter (or possibly a vlan filter) to match the SSID and role to 
reject the clients?  Something like

[ssid]
filter = ssid
operator = is
value = OPENSSID

[role]
filter = user_role
operator = is
value = SOMEROLE

[1:ssid&role]
scope = returnRadiusAccessAccept
merge_answer = no
answer1 =  RLM_MODULE_REJECT?

Not really sure how to reject the radius request.
